This isn’t a chapter update just yet (but a big one is coming very soon so keep an eye out ✨). I wanted to share a small system I’m adding to help me stay organized with my R4R exchanges.
Lately I’ve taken on many more R4Rs, and while I genuinely want to uphold my side of every agreement, I’ve noticed that some authors don’t return the exchange, even though they continue posting and interacting on Wattpad/Reddit/Etc.
This isn’t directed at anyone who is on hiatus, busy, or dealing with life. Life happens, and I understand that fully. This is simply for authors who remain active but do not continue our R4R after the first few chapters.
To keep things fair and manageable, I’m using three lists:
✨ Active R4R List:
For authors currently reading and engaging with my story.
✨ Completed R4R List:
For exchanges where both sides have fulfilled their parts.
✨ “R4R Purgatory” List:
If an author is active but hasn’t returned to my story after three weeks, their book moves here.
The intention is not to punish, but as a gentle reminder and a way to stay organized.
If they come back, comment, vote, or continue reading, I immediately move their book back to the active list.
If several more weeks pass with no interaction, I’ll quietly consider the exchange closed so I can focus on genuine, ongoing reads.
